PATRIARCHAL REPRODUCTION OF WOMEN’S GENDER IDEOLOGY IN THE PAKPAK FAMILY, INDONESIA
This study deconstructs the role of women as reproductive people in patriarchy through cases of marginalization of women in the Pakpak community in Pegagan Julu VIII village, Dairi District, North Sumatra, Indonesia.
